Biology and Management of Economically Important Lepidopteran Cereal Stem Borers in Africa

Cereals (maize, sorghum, millet, rice) are extremely important crops grown in Africa for human consumption. Of the various insect pests attacking cereal crops in Africa, lepidopteran stem borers are by far the most injurious. All 21 economically important stem borers of cultivated grasses in Africa are indigenous except Chilo partellus, which invaded the continent from India, and C. sacchariphagus, which has recently been found in sugarcane in Mozambique. C. partellus is competitively displacing indigenous stem borers in East and southern Africa. A parasitoid, Cotesia flavipes, was introduced from Pakistan for biological control of C. partellus and caused a 32-55% decrease in stem borer densities. This article is an attempt to summarize the status of knowledge about economically important cereal stem borers in Africa with emphasis on their distribution, pest status and yield losses, diapause, natural enemies, cultural control, host plant resistance, and biological control. Special attention is given to Busseola fusca and C. partellus, the most important pests of maize and grain sorghum.

Biology, immature stages and rearing of cocoa-capsids (Miridae: Heteroptera)

Some aspects of the biology of four West African capsid pests of Cocoa, Distantiella theobroma (Distant), Sahlbergella singularis Haglund, Bryocoropsis laticollis Schumacher and Helopeltis corbisieri Schmitz (Miridae: Heteroptera) are briefly summarized. Their immature stages are described and sketched in detail. Keys to distinguish all the larval stages are given and the techniques for rearing them reviewed. The systematics of Bryocorinae is discussed.
